Day to Day Responsibilities:
• Provide technical support to manufacturing teams, resolving design-related issues, implementing process improvements, and optimizing production workflows.
• Utilize computer-aided design (CAD) software (e.g., SolidWorks, CATIA) to create detailed 3D models, drawings, and specifications for mechanical parts and assemblies.
• Perform engineering analysis and simulations to validate design concepts, optimize performance, and ensure compliance with technical specifications, industry standards, and regulatory requirements.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including electrical engineering, process engineering, procurement, and production to introduce new equipment or new process.
Education & Experience
• BS degree in Mechanical, or Mechatronics. Master is preferred.
• 3+ years’ experience of manufacturing experience.
• Ability to independently finish complex and various mechanical equipment design.
Required Skills
• Rich troubleshooting of mechanical issues.
• Has curiosity, loves to study, and the ability to continuously learn.
• Knowledge of manufacturing processes, materials selection, and fabrication techniques used in producing mechanical components and systems.
Desired Skills
• Proficiency in computer-aided design (CAD) software, with experience in 3D modeling, drafting, and simulation.
• Strong understanding of mechanical engineering principles, including statics, dynamics, materials science, and thermodynamics.
Soft Skills
• Sense of urgency and creativity to handle project issues and adapt plan to meet objectives.
• Excellent problem-solving skills, with the ability to analyze complex issues, identify root causes, and implement effective solutions.
• Strong project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ities, deadlines, and stakeholders.
